One year I had massive trouble getting enough together to pay on time. I called my tax office and explained and they were great. Gave me a few months extra and no fees or interest. Early communication is the key with HMRC.
 
I'm just subbying now so mine is stopped auto. Then just do tax return online the 2nd week in April ( after the year end is up ) , then 5 days later the taxman puts it back in my bank account.
